What Sorts of Therapy For PTSD Are Available?
Treatment for PTSD aids you find out to handle your signs and symptoms and reclaim control of your life. It can involve oral medications or talk therapies. Psychotherapy, or talk therapy, is the most typical treatment for PTSD. It can take place one-on-one or in a group setup.


Symptoms of PTSD can range from being conveniently shocked to preventing tasks and individuals. These signs and symptoms can additionally influence family members and children.

C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T).
CBT focuses on altering unfavorable patterns of believing and habits that might be creating PTSD signs. This treatment is generally temporary and client-centered, with the therapist and client creating therapy goals together. CBT has actually been revealed to minimize PTSD signs in numerous professional tests utilizing clinician-administered and self-report procedures of PTSD. These results are mediated largely by adjustments in maladaptive cognitive distortions, with some researches reporting physical, useful neuroimaging, and electroencephalographic adjustments correlating with action to CBT.

TF-CBT utilizes psychoeducation and imaginal exposure to educate customers exactly how to better control feelings and deal with their traumas. This treatment has actually additionally been revealed to improve PTSD signs and symptoms in kids and adolescents.

Eye movement desensitization and reprocessing (EMDR).
EMDR is an evidence-based treatment that functions by helping individuals process injury making use of flexible information processing. It can be made use of by itself or with various other therapies. It has been revealed to be effective in dealing with PTSD. EMDR is extensively utilized around the world.

It begins with history-taking and a collective treatment strategy. Throughout this phase, you will speak about the factor you are seeking therapy and determine traumatic memories you wish to focus on. The therapist will certainly additionally educate you strategies to handle any kind of difficult or disturbing feelings that might emerge during a session.

Throughout the reprocessing phase, you will remember a traumatic memory while paying attention to a back-and-forth motion or audio (like your provider's hand crossing your face) till the negative pictures, thoughts, and sensations associated with it start to decrease.

Somatic experiencing.
A specialist who focuses on this approach will certainly help you familiarize the physical experiences that accompany your PTSD signs and symptoms. They'll likewise teach you just how to identify your free nerve system and its duty in the trauma feedback.

Unlike various other injury treatments, somatic experiencing does not concentrate on memories or emotions. Rather, therapists function to release the tension from your body and soothe your signs and symptoms.

This therapy has actually been discovered effective in a number of randomized controlled tests. Nonetheless, the arise from these studies are limited by little sample sizes and various other technical deficiencies. These drawbacks limit the external validity of these searchings for.

Present-centered treatment.
Present-centered therapy mental wellness (PCT) is a non-trauma focused psychotherapy that aims to improve people' relationships, instill hope and positive outlook, and advertise analytic. While PCT lacks exposure and cognitive restructuring techniques of trauma-focused treatments, it has actually been shown to be as efficient in minimizing PTSD signs as trauma-focused CBTs.

In a series of eleven studies, PCT was compared to a wait listing or very little get in touch with control condition and to TF-CBT. PCT was superior to the WL/MA conditions in decreasing self-reported PTSD symptoms at post-treatment, and it was connected with decreased treatment dropout rates. However, the effect dimension was not large sufficient to be scientifically meaningful.

Dual diagnosis therapy.
Signs of co-occurring PTSD and compound make use of condition (SUD) are commonly connected and both have to be attended to in healing. People that experience PTSD can be more probable to turn to alcohol or medications to self-medicate and temporarily alleviate intrusive ideas, flashbacks and adverse mood swings.

PTSD signs and symptoms consist of persistent and uncontrolled traumatic memories or desires, brilliant and dissociative reactions that seem like reliving the occasion, avoiding areas, people, conversations, or things connected with the injury, feelings of hypervigilance and being always on guard or conveniently stunned, and sensations of emotional numbness.

Double medical diagnosis treatment involves therapy and learning healthier coping devices. It may likewise entail pharmacotherapy, such as antidepressants or mood stabilizers.
